Reason Branch is a 3.04 mi (4.89 km) long 1st order tributary to the Rocky River in Union County, North Carolina. This is the only stream of this name in the United States.

Course

Reason Branch rises in a pond about 1 mile west of New Salem, North Carolina and then flows northeast to join the Rocky River about 3 miles north-northwest of New Salem.[2]

Watershed

Reason Branch drains 3.25 square miles (8.4 km2) of area, receives about 48.0 in/year of precipitation, has a wetness index of 393.52, and is about 43% forested.[4]
